Sica, semi-scherp Sprookje horseman’s picks also became statusThe Sica was a short scimitar that was developed in the Hallstatt period. It was used by Hallstatt Celts, Illyrians, Thracians, Dacians and later by the Romans. This weapon was also used during the Roman gladiator battles. This Sica has a wooden grip and a pommel. The blade is made of EN45 feather steel.
